This component, responsible for handling Webhook Subscriptions, fails to properly validate the 'url' parameter provided during configuration or execution. An unauthenticated remote attacker can exploit this flaw by supplying a crafted URL to the webhook service, forcing the application to perform requests on behalf of the server. This can lead to unauthorized access to internal services, metadata endpoints, or external resources. Public exploit code is currently available, and the vendor has not provided a patch or formal response to the disclosure, making this a high-priority risk for organizations running Hyperledger FireFly instances.</p>
<h2 id="impact">Impact</h2>
<p>Successful exploitation allows an attacker to bypass perimeter security to scan and interact with internal network resources, potentially leading to unauthorized data exfiltration or access to sensitive internal APIs. As the vulnerability is remote and requires no authentication, instances exposed to the internet are at immediate risk of exploitation.</p>
<h2 id="recommendation">Recommendation</h2>
<p>Prioritize network-level segmentation to restrict the ability of the Hyperledger FireFly service to make outbound connections to internal and private IP ranges (e.g., 10.0.0.0/8, 172.16.0.0/12, 192.168.0.0/16). Monitor webserver logs for unexpected requests to internal infrastructure or unusual URL patterns targeting administrative interfaces. Ensure that the FireFly service runs with the least privilege necessary to minimize the impact if an SSRF condition is successfully triggered.</p>
